Output 83dff4a6814871f0f1bfde913575989fa121c6c4d7bb9ba1fd77c6ed42e09b50:0

value
1838594
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26b44a1bc98880ff214aa4f997b068ddfa8ae0b2 OP_EQUALVERIFY OP_CHECKSIG
address
14Xef2KKNgyfWLd5hjDCH8v9Gdx9VscT28
transaction
83dff4a6814871f0f1bfde913575989fa121c6c4d7bb9ba1fd77c6ed42e09b50
confirmations
500018
spent
true